If you have been on The Edge website recently, you may have noticed a new section: podcasts! Jake Kaufman, a sophomore at St. Edward, has started up a sports broadcast called “Sideline Sports” through a series of podcasts. Kaufman’s interest in radio is started with sports, listening to the WGN radio broadcasts of the Bulls, Bears, Blackhawks and Sox on the road. Kaufman says, “I noticed how the broadcasters still made you feel like you were there at the game with the excitement in their voice…On air, voice is all you got and it can be a challenge. But, I like a challenge.”

Kaufman sure does like a challenge, and since then, he has attended a broadcasting camp for two summers. The camp introduces aspiring radio announcers to the different types of play-by-play sports, from a slower paced baseball game to a fast paced hockey game. “The camp gave me the opportunity to experience the various sports and see if it’s something I want to pursue professionally as a career” says Kaufman. Through the camp, he was able to attend teach sessions by and meet well-known announcers from ESPN.

Kaufman now brings this passion for radio to the Greenwave, having interviewed Coach Ro, quarterback Dylan Milnarich, and most recently, the 2016 senior football players. His podcasts are featured on The Edge website, under the sports section.

In the near future, Jake hopes to continue his podcasts. “For now, I’d like to continue interviews with students playing on St. Ed’s winter and spring sports teams and have big plans to do a March Madness broadcast with a special guest” Keep checking the website, and we’ll find out more about that in the spring!

Kaufman has big plans for the future, aspiring to eventually create a St. Edward radio show, not only covering sports, but things like mini plays and random acts of kindness as well. “I can’t believe I’m saying this, but there are lots of other interesting things to talk about on air besides sports!” he commented. However, Kaufman can’t do it alone, so he hopes to recruit some other St. Ed’s students passionate about radio broadcasting.
